Abstract

Caring for family members who suffer from mental disorders at home is not easy and causes various problems for other family members. Problems often experienced by families include physical, psychological, social, financial and family function problems that can disrupt mental health. This research aims to determine the description of mental health in families who care for people with mental disorders. The method in this research was descriptive. The population in this study were families who had family members with mental disorders in the Jatibarang Community Health Center Work Area. The research sampling technique used purposive sampling on 73 respondents. The instrument used the Self Reporting Questionnaire (SRQ) with 20 question items. Data analysis used univariate analysis. The research was found that 62% of respondents did not experience emotional mental disorders and 38% experienced emotional mental disorders. The conclusion of this research was that 38% of families experience mental health problems (emotional mental disorders). Suggestions for health workers are expected to provide appropriate interventions to families in an effort to prevent mental health problems and provide support to families to ease the burden of family care in caring for people with mental disorders.
